Disclosed are a method and an apparatus for synchronizing quantum data start points between a transmitting device and a receiving device in a quantum key distribution system. According to an aspect of the present invention, a method for enabling a receiving device and a transmitting device of a quantum key distribution (QKD) system to determine start points at which a quantum key distribution protocol commences is characterized in comprising: a process of measuring a modulated optical pulse sequence of a specific pattern which is periodically transmitted from the transmitting device via a quantum channel, wherein the modulated optical pulse sequence of a specific pattern includes a specific quantum signal only at a specific time point within one period; a process of determining whether periodicity of the measured result satisfies a preset statistical condition, wherein the statistical condition is that the number of occurrences of measurement events of the specific quantum signal at a specific time point within one period should reach a preset number; a process of, when the statistical condition is satisfied, transmitting an acknowledgement signal to the transmitting device; and a process of determining a time point, which has elapsed from the time point at which the statistical condition is satisfied by a preset time period, as the start point. According to the present invention, before a quantum key distribution protocol commences or when a problem occurs in the quantum key distribution system, the start points of quantum data can be synchronized by performing a software-based logic, and therefore, errors or losses in the quantum signal due to a strong synchronous signal can be prevented. |
